SECOND BROWN GAME.

Stillman and Hatch to Pitch.--Closer Game than First One Expected.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The nine will play its second game with Brown at Providence this afternoon. The squad will leave at 10 o'clock this morning.

Brown lost to Harvard 3 to 1 in the first game but played well. Since then, bad defeats by Pennsylvania and Holy Cross have indicated a slump in the work of the team. An easy game today can not be expected, however, as Harvard has not been able to hit Washburn successfully yet.
